What Is Hdmi Arc?
- Hdmi arc (audio return channel) is a feature available on certain hdmi-equipped devices that allows them to send and receive audio signals over a single hdmi cable.
- It simplifies the connectivity between audio devices, such as soundbars, and the tv, eliminating the need for multiple cables.
- Hdmi arc operates through the same hdmi cable that connects the tv and soundbar, making it a convenient and efficient solution for delivering high-quality audio.
How Does Hdmi Arc Work?
- When a soundbar and a tv are connected via hdmi arc, the tv can send audio signals to the soundbar without the need for an additional audio cable.
- The audio from the tv, such as from built-in apps or live tv channels, is transmitted back to the soundbar through the hdmi arc channel.
- The soundbar then processes and amplifies the audio signals, delivering immersive sound to enhance the viewing experience.
- Hdmi arc also allows for two-way communication, enabling control of the soundbar using the tv remote.

Step-By-Step Guide To Connecting Soundbars With Hdmi Arc:
- Ensure that your soundbar and tv have hdmi arc ports.
- Connect one end of the hdmi cable to the hdmi arc port on your tv.
- Connect the other end of the hdmi cable to the hdmi arc port on your soundbar.
- Turn on your tv and soundbar.
- Access the settings menu on your tv and navigate to the audio settings.
- Select the option to enable hdmi arc or earc.
- Adjust the soundbar settings according to your preference.
- Test the connection by playing audio through the soundbar. Ensure that the sound is coming from the soundbar and not the tv speakers.
- If the sound is still coming from the tv speakers, try troubleshooting common issues (explained below).
- Enjoy the enhanced audio experience with your connected soundbar!
Troubleshooting Common Issues When Connecting Soundbars With Hdmi Arc:
- Verify that both the soundbar and tv are arc compatible.
- Ensure that the hdmi cables are securely connected to the correct ports on both the tv and soundbar.
- Check if the hdmi arc settings are enabled on both the tv and soundbar.
- Restart both the tv and soundbar.
- If the sound is still not coming from the soundbar, try disabling any other audio output options on your tv (such as tv speakers or external speakers).
- Update the firmware of both the tv and the soundbar to the latest versions.
- Try using a different hdmi cable to rule out any cable issues.
- Reset the soundbar to its factory settings and set it up again.
- Consult the user manuals of your tv and soundbar for specific troubleshooting steps.

Optimizing Audio Settings With Hdmi Arc:
- Adjust sound mode: Experiment with different sound modes on your soundbar to find the one that suits your preferences. Some popular sound modes include movie, music, and game.
- Fine-tune equalizer settings: Use the equalizer settings on your soundbar to enhance specific frequencies and customize the sound according to your liking. Adjusting bass, treble, and mid-range frequencies can greatly improve the audio experience.
- Enable virtual surround sound: If your soundbar supports virtual surround sound technology, enable it to create a more immersive audio environment. This feature uses advanced audio processing to simulate a surround sound setup.
- Configure audio delay: If you notice a delay between the sound and visuals while using hdmi arc, adjust the audio delay settings on your soundbar to synchronize them. This eliminates any lip-sync issues and ensures a seamless viewing experience.
